Abstract

The invention discloses an axial cone mirror cone angle detection device and method. The device is composed of a collimator, a focusing lens and an image sensor. According to the position relation of the collimator, the focusing lens and the image sensor, the focusing lens and the image sensor are sequentially arranged in the outgoing beam direction of the collimator, and an insertion opening of an axial cone mirror to be detected is arranged between the collimator and the focusing lens. The axial cone mirror cone angle detection device has the advantages that the structure is simple, measuring of the axial cone mirror at any angle can be easily achieved, and cone angles of the axial cone mirror at different positions can also be measured.

technical field [0001] The invention relates to the field of optical detection, in particular to an axicon cone angle detection device and a detection method thereof. technical background [0002] The axicon is a rotationally symmetrical pyramidal optical element whose focal line is along the optical axis. Because it can provide a long focal depth for the optical system, it is used in laser beam shaping, laser drilling technology, optical detection, laser resonators, Aspects such as the generation of non-diffraction beams are widely used, and the use of axicon mirrors in lithography illumination systems can achieve ring illumination patterns. This puts forward strict requirements on the manufacturing accuracy of the tapered surface, and the measurement of the cone angle of the axicon mirror needs an accurate method to realize.
